Neogen Corporation re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.09, significantly surpassing the analyst consensus estimate of $0.0587 by 53.32%. Revenue figures were not available for comparison. Despite the substantial earnings beat, shares declined by 0.85% in the immediate aftermath, suggesting mixed investor sentiment regarding top-line performance and broader macroeconomic pressures.

Management attributed the strong bottom-line results to continued operational efficiencies and disciplined cost management across its animal safety and food safety segments. The company highlighted progress in its supply chain optimization initiatives, which contributed to improved gross margins compared to the prior-year period. While specific revenue numbers were not disclosed, management noted that demand for diagnostic solutions and genomics services remained steady, particularly from livestock producers focused on herd health and biosecurity. On the margin front, Neogen’s focus on higher-margin consumable products helped offset inflationary pressures on raw materials and logistics. The company also emphasized investments in digital platforms to streamline customer ordering and enhance service delivery. However, management acknowledged that foreign exchange headwinds and competitive pricing in certain international markets could temper segment growth in the near term. Looking ahead, Neogen’s management reaffirmed its cautious optimism for fiscal 2026, expecting continued sequential improvement in profitability as integration benefits from previous acquisitions are realized. The company anticipates that ongoing product innovation—particularly in rapid pathogen detection and DNA-based animal identification—may support market share gains in both the food safety and animal health verticals. However, management flagged that lingering inflationary pressures and potential shifts in government livestock subsidies could pose risks to volume growth in the second half of the fiscal year. Strategic priorities include expanding distribution partnerships in Asia-Pacific and Latin America, as well as advancing automation in manufacturing facilities to reduce unit costs. No formal quantitative guidance for the full year or upcoming quarters was provided, but the company reiterated its commitment to achieving mid-single-digit organic revenue growth over the long term. The market’s 0.85% decline in Neogen’s stock following the earnings release indicates that investors may have been looking for stronger top-line momentum to complement the profit beat. Analysts from several investment banks noted that the magnitude of the EPS surprise—more than 50% above consensus—was encouraging, but they cautioned that sustainable growth will require measurable revenue acceleration. Several analysts revised their near-term price targets slightly downward, citing the lack of revenue disclosure and cautious management commentary on foreign exchange and input cost pressures. Key metrics for investors to monitor in subsequent quarters include organic revenue growth rates, segment-level margin trends, and any updates on the company’s debt reduction timeline.
